More secondary suites are now likely to be constructed within homes in Squamish. Council passed third reading of the fees and charges bylaw Tuesday night. From Jan. 20, 2016, to Jan. 31, 2017, building permit fees will be waived for the construction and alteration to a secondary site or accessory residential dwelling. 

The waiving of the fees came out of a district housing task force recommendation, according to Councillor Jason Blackman-Wulff, chair of the task force, in order to encourage more affordable housing options for renters in Squamish. The bylaw still has to be adopted at a future council meeting.
